Applies to glycerin / petrolatum / phenylephrine / pramoxine topical: rectal cream.

Important warnings This medicine can cause some serious health issues

Ask a doctor or pharmacist before using this medicine if you are using a medication to treat asthma, COPD, or depression.

Get emergency medical help if you have signs of an allergic reaction: hives; difficult breathing; swelling of your face, lips, tongue, or throat.
